REPORTS SHOWING LONG-TERM WEIGHT LOSS AFTER TUMMY TUCKS

Most overweight patients show lasting weight loss one year after abdominoplasty Long-term weight loss after abdominoplasty (“tummy tuck”) may be related to increased satiety-feeling full after eating, according to the study by ASPS Member Surgeon Dr. Rex Edward Moulton-Barrett of Alameda Hospital and colleagues.
